Field Assets Supervisor Job Description: We are seeking a detail-oriented and organized Field Assets Supervisor to join our Team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for managing inventory, tracking tools and assets, handling shipping and receiving, and maintaining accurate records within the tracking system. To be successful, this role will continue to contribute to a growth mind-set of improvement and efficiency. This role involves managing iPhone and iPad inventory, including resetting and returning devices to stock. Additional duties may be assigned as needed. Primary Responsibilities:
